Output 2664ba6801dedb62abf1a743aeaa6e7c91562f1170a86369f431bd35b4be64e9:19

value
1990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a38f80924a4ef5e730656298b8ea01b298a590e8 OP_EQUAL
address
3GbqyXEH2AVZZjwxpNxYEbZGSFHBLeBX5A
transaction
2664ba6801dedb62abf1a743aeaa6e7c91562f1170a86369f431bd35b4be64e9
spent
true